Board.KolibriOS.org

Официальный форум KolibriOS
Текущее время: Пн июн 25, 2018 5:42 am

Часовой пояс: UTC+03:00




Начать новую тему  Ответить на тему  [ 101 сообщение ]  На страницу Пред. 1 2 3 4 57 След.
Автор Сообщение
 Заголовок сообщения:
СообщениеДобавлено: Пт май 12, 2006 7:01 pm 
Wildwest
Раньше она вообще не обнаруживалась. В последней версии выложенной на форуме (не твоя) определилась, но с неизвестным атрибутом для фирмы производителя. Теперь в этой версии все правильно, спасибо за труды.


Вернуться к началу
   
 Заголовок сообщения:
СообщениеДобавлено: Пт май 12, 2006 9:08 pm 
Не в сети

Зарегистрирован: Ср май 18, 2005 7:27 pm
Сообщения: 1001
Хорошо, что баги фиксятся. Вообще-то фирма называется ESS Technology, Inc. - можешь исправить в исходнике.


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Сб май 13, 2006 3:37 pm 
Wildwest
А почему ты сам не исправил? Вроде последние изменения от тебя, а я как то вроде боком к этой программе. Во всяком случае ничего для нее не делал. :-)


Вернуться к началу
   
 Заголовок сообщения:
СообщениеДобавлено: Пн май 15, 2006 3:35 pm 
Не в сети
Kernel Developer
Аватара пользователя

Зарегистрирован: Пн ноя 28, 2005 8:00 pm
Сообщения: 1601
http://diamondz.land.ru/pcidev.gif

_________________
Ушёл к умным, знающим и культурным людям.


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Ср май 17, 2006 3:09 pm 
Не в сети

Зарегистрирован: Пн апр 10, 2006 7:22 am
Сообщения: 76
Код:
PCI Version=0210
Last PCI Bus=02
Quantity of devices=03
VenID  DevID  Bus#  Dev#  Rev  Class  Subclass  Company                           Descriptoin
8086    2560    00      00       03     06        00         INTEL CORP.                      Bridge - CPU/PCI
8086    2561    00      08       03     06        04         INTEL CORP.                      Bridge - PCI/PCI
10DE   0181    01      00       A4     03        00         NVIDIA CORPORATION       Display - VGA controller

А BIOS намного больше устройств показывает


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Пт май 19, 2006 6:46 pm 
Не в сети

Зарегистрирован: Ср май 18, 2005 7:27 pm
Сообщения: 1001
>А BIOS намного больше устройств показывает

Использовал PCIDEV 1.31 (последний)? Вообще, чем больше будет информации о непоказываемых устройствах, тем проще будет разобраться с твоей проблемой.


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Сб май 20, 2006 1:33 pm 
Теперь вроде все устройства обнаруживаются! Почему этого нельзя было сделать раньше? Я все думал что ошибка где-то в коде работы с PCI в функциях ядра, что портило мне настроение не один месяц.


Вернуться к началу
   
 Заголовок сообщения:
СообщениеДобавлено: Сб май 20, 2006 2:05 pm 
Не в сети

Зарегистрирован: Пн апр 10, 2006 7:22 am
Сообщения: 76
А откуда его качать?


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Сб май 20, 2006 2:40 pm 
Не в сети
Аватара пользователя

Зарегистрирован: Чт май 19, 2005 4:43 pm
Сообщения: 896
Я так понял,что здесь
http://www.board.flatassembler.net/topi ... 69&start=0

У меня тоже все устройства показывает!


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Пн май 22, 2006 6:29 pm 
Не в сети

Зарегистрирован: Ср май 18, 2005 7:27 pm
Сообщения: 1001
> Почему этого нельзя было сделать раньше?

Разработчики открытых проектов надеются, что их сотоварищи не сделают ошибок, и обычно не проверяют чужой код. К сожалению...


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Вт май 23, 2006 6:37 am 
Не в сети

Зарегистрирован: Пн апр 10, 2006 7:22 am
Сообщения: 76
Теперь все устройства, только, по-моему, PCIDEV не показывает IRQ


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Ср май 24, 2006 6:54 pm 
O01eg
Он его не показывает, потому что многие устройства после перехода в защищенный режим так и остаются не повешенными на прерывания. В этом плане нам еще работать и работать с ядром.


Вернуться к началу
   
 Заголовок сообщения:
СообщениеДобавлено: Ср май 24, 2006 10:01 pm 
Не в сети
Kernel Developer

Зарегистрирован: Ср мар 08, 2006 6:25 pm
Сообщения: 3948
Прерывания назначает БИОС, они должны быть записаны в конфигурационном пр-ве PCI


Вернуться к началу
 Заголовок сообщения:
СообщениеДобавлено: Чт май 25, 2006 5:33 pm 
Serge
При переходе в защищенный режим ос должна заново развешивать прерывания и она их может развесить так, как ей захочется, если это вообще позволено железом.


Вернуться к началу
   
 Заголовок сообщения:
СообщениеДобавлено: Чт май 25, 2006 8:47 pm 
Не в сети
Kernel Developer

Зарегистрирован: Ср мар 08, 2006 6:25 pm
Сообщения: 3948
Mario79
Это я знаю. Но пока Колибри этого не делает можно показывать те IRQ, что назначает БИОС. Я не проверял специально, но думаю что БИОС назначает IRQ всем устройствам, как делает это для АС97.


Вернуться к началу
Показать сообщения за:  Поле сортировки  
Начать новую тему  Ответить на тему  [ 101 сообщение ]  На страницу Пред. 1 2 3 4 57 След.

Часовой пояс: UTC+03:00


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 1 гость


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Создано на основе phpBB® Forum Software © phpBB Limited
Русская поддержка phpBB